2D AUTOMATED OPTICAL INSPECTION
Microart Services Selects QX250i™ 2D AOI System for Diverse Inspection Needs
Microart Services Inc., founded in 1981, is an industry-leading electronic contract manufacturing
company. Microart utilizes high-speed automation and advanced equipment to deliver high-
mix, high-complexity assembly solutions to its diverse customer base.
Challenge
Microart needed an automated solution for post-solder inspection on a variety of boards with a range of
applications. Microart’s rapidly growing business demanded an increasing supply of highly skilled labor, but the
breadth and diversity of their services made locating talent with the requisite training a challenge. As a result,
Microart sought a technological replacement which could provide advanced inspection capabilities in order to
continue delivering high-quality products to their customers.
Solution
After a comparative analysis of CyberOptics’ and competitors’ products, Microart deemed the CyberOptics QX250i
2D AOI system was best-suited for their needs. The sensor technology of the QX250i provides fast, high-resolution
inspection for all applications—pre-reow, post-selective solder, and post-reow inspection—delivering clear
images for accurate defect review. The QX250i has exceeded expectations regarding accuracy and resolution and
has allowed Microart to utilize data they had previously never been able to gather.
Central to the QX250i AOI systems are dual top and bottom mounted SIMs
(Strobed Inspection Module), a sensor technology designed and manufactured
exclusively by CyberOptics. The SIM delivers fast performance at 110cm/sec
and requires no manual adjustment. This highly accurate automated system
has greatly increased the ecacy and speed of Microart’s inspection processes,
allowing them to ramp up the rate of inspection by a factor of 2-3x.

The QX software utilizes AI (Autonomous Image Interpretation) technology, designed for low volume - high
mix, and high volume - low mix applications. Programming is faster and simpler - with a 90% reduction in
examples required to create a complete production ready program that helps achieve superior defect detection
and low false call rates with just one example. Microart has found the QX250i with QX software to be extremely
straightforward to install and use and plans to invest in more QX250i systems in the near future. In addition to
its ease-of-use and impressive accuracy and speeds, the QX250i provides Microart the overarching benet of a
heightened quality guarantee to its customers.

About Microart Services
Established in 1981, Microart Services, Inc., is a full-service electronic manufacturing and design services company
servicing the North American and European markets from the greater Toronto area. Microart serves 300 customers
a month on average and completes 1000 unique jobs per month. The company provides circuit design, PCB
layout, bare board manufacturing, PCB assembly testing and box build, and supply chain services. Their customers
come from a wide variety of industries, including as medical, marine, military, robotics, consumer goods, and
telecom, among others. Discover more at microartservices.com
